Geopolitical tensions in Iran have triggered market jitters, pushing oil prices higher and increasing volatility, despite recent improvements in U.S. economic sentiment. Consumers are now expressing reduced confidence in their financial outlook.
- Iran conflict escalation coincided with improved U.S. economic sentiment
- CL=F rose due to supply disruption fears
- ^VIX increased, indicating higher market volatility
- XLE saw renewed investor attention amid defense and energy concerns
- Consumers across income levels reported declining financial expectations
